What is Agentic?

Agentic is a powerful AI automation tool designed to help developers, teams, and entrepreneurs build and deploy autonomous AI agents and workflows with ease. It combines the flexibility of coding with the simplicity of no-code interfaces, making it suitable for both technical and non-technical users.

Whether you’re building a customer support bot, automating a business process, or crafting a data analysis pipeline, Agentic provides a robust environment to orchestrate large language models (LLMs) and integrate various APIs and tools into seamless, intelligent workflows.

With its intuitive interface and modular design, Agentic aims to eliminate the friction in AI development, allowing users to go from idea to deployment rapidly without compromising on customization or scalability.

 

Key Features

  • Visual Workflow Builder

Create sophisticated AI workflows using a drag-and-drop interface. You can chain tasks, apply conditional logic, and set up looped executions—all without writing a single line of code.

  • Multi-Model Support

Easily integrate and switch between various LLMs such as GPT-4, Claude, and open-source models, depending on your task requirements and budget.

  • Plugin & API Integration

Agentic supports integration with external APIs and tools, allowing you to plug your workflows into CRMs, databases, Slack, Gmail, and other commonly used platforms.

  • Reusable Templates

Access a library of pre-built templates for common tasks like lead generation, content summarization, and data scraping—saving time and effort on repetitive projects.

  • Real-Time Debugging

Test and debug your AI workflows in real time with detailed logs, intermediate outputs, and step-by-step visualization for improved transparency and reliability.

❌ Cons

  • Learning Curve for Complex Logic

While basic workflows are easy to set up, building complex multi-step logic might still require technical knowledge or experimentation.

  • Limited Free Tier

The freemium plan offers limited execution time and fewer integrations, which may not be sufficient for users with high-volume or enterprise needs.

  • Third-Party Dependency

Since it relies on external LLMs and APIs, performance and uptime may be influenced by those third-party services.

Pricing

Agentic offers flexible pricing based on usage levels and feature access, catering to individuals, startups, and growing teams.

  • Plan 1: Starter – Free
  • Basic workflow creation
  • Limited runs per month
  • Access to core features
  • Community support
  • Plan 2: Pro – $29/month
  • Increased workflow runs
  • Priority LLM access
  • API integrations
  • Email support
  • Plan 3: Enterprise – Custom Pricing
  • Unlimited runs
  • Team collaboration features
  • Advanced monitoring and logs
  • Dedicated support and onboarding
